Dominque Brightmon has been speaking on this topic for several years now. Probably for as long as I’ve known him, if not more. He shares tips and techniques that will help you to become better in your job, career and in life.

Dominique was raised in the church where he was taught fundamental life lessons and received a head start with public speaking. This early start led him to win 3rd place at a state level speech competition during grade school. While in high school, Dominique took a summer job at a public library to gain experience. After a successful summer performance, he was invited to work there part-time. Since then he has risen through the ranks and gained over a decade of customer service experience.

Thanks to his work experience and having read hundreds of books, Dominique always leaves his audiences with useful tips and strategies. His aim is to help others become better versions of themselves through reading and other forms of self-development.

As an active member of Toastmasters International, Dominique has given dozens of inspirational talks and was awarded for his leadership in 2016 as an Area Director. He was the youngest Area Director in the region at the age of 23.

Dominique has also appeared on many media outlets such as E-Life Media, Fox 45 news, & Toastmasters International Magazine. In addition to appearing on many media outlets, he has created his own, called the “Going North” podcast which interviews authors from all over the world.
